The synthesis of small cycloalkyl boronic esters

Abstract

Small cycloalkyl boronic esters are valuable structural motifs in synthetic chemistry, owing to the spatial definition of substituents imparted by their ring strain-induced rigid carbon scaffold. The boronic ester can also act as a handle for further functionalisation.

Their stereocontrolled synthesis can be achieved through strain-release and ring expansion/contraction chemistry.

The synthesis of medicinally relevant substituted cyclobutyl boronic esters from easily accessible 5 membered ring boronate complexes via a ring contraction is to be investigated.
